Choya Kokuto Umeshu

Choya Kokuto Umeshu

Luxuriously rich and mellow, Choya Kokuto Umeshu masterfully balances tart Kishu Nanko ume with the deep sweetness of 100% Okinawan kokuto (black sugar) and a whisper of dark rum. It captivates with its caramel, dried fruits, and gentle smoky warmth—perfect neat, with ice, or as a decadent dessert sipper


Origins & Craftsmanship

Crafted by Choya—the world’s largest producer of authentic umeshu—this expression is made from just four ingredients: Kishu Nanko ume, kokuto (100% brown sugar), cane spirit, and Jamaican dark rum. Each 720 ml bottle incorporates around 165 grams of ume fruit


Tasting Profile

  • Aroma & Flavor: Rich notes of dark rum, caramel, dried apricot, and plum, with subtle smoky and honeyed layers. The ume’s fruitiness and kokuto’s molasses depth create a warm, indulgent bouquet.

  • Palate & Finish: Silky and lush—it blends dried fruit sweetness with a touch of smoke and mineral nuance, culminating in a warming, dessert-like finish reminiscent of burnt caramel.


Serving & Pairings

Elegant served neat or on the rocks, Choya Kokuto Umeshu also inspires creative cocktail use or can be drizzled over vanilla ice cream for luxurious dessert indulgence.


Awards & Recognition

Honored with a Gold Award at the San Francisco World Spirits Competition (2021), this liqueur stands out as a flavored umeshu benchmark


Quick Overview

Characteristic Description
Ume Variety Kishu Nanko ume (Japan)
Sweetener & Spirit 100% kokuto (black sugar), cane spirit, and dark rum (Jamaican)
ABV 14% alcohol by volume 
Flavor Profile Caramel, dried apricot, plum, a hint of smoke/mineral, rich and smooth
Serving Style Neat, chilled on the rocks, as dessert topper, or in cocktails
Awards Gold Award, SFWSC 2021
Producer Choya Umeshu Co., Ltd—global umeshu leader (est. 1914)
